摘要
The aim of this work is to improve the diagnosis of cervical cancer by introducing laser polarimetry and spectropolarization methods of investigation. We have proposed a novel approach for the differentiation of squamous cell carcinoma and cervical adenocarcinoma using laser optics. The use of the method of laser polarimetry according to the Stokes parameter S-4 makes it possible to reliably differentiate the norm from cancer in a native smear, as well as adenocarcinoma from squamous cell carcinoma in a smear-print. The method of spectropolarimetry allows reliably accurately distinguishing the normal epithelium of the cervix from cancer of the cervix, and the parameters of linear dichroism during the spectropolarization study, reliably (p=0,001) differentiate between normal, adenocarcinoma and flat cell cancer of the cervix.
